Dale Pirie Cabot died November 14, 2025 at her home in Westwood, MA. Dale was born May 6, 1931 in Chicago, IL. She grew up in Lake Forest, IL, attending the Bell School. She later graduated from Miss Porter’s School in Farmington, CT. While attending college in Boston, she met Charles C. Cabot, Jr. They were married in 1953 and settled in Dover, MA, where they built a house and gardens and raised three children.
Dale was a source of unconditional love and support for so many: children, grandchildren, great grandchildren, extended family, not to mention the astonishing number of friends of all ages and walks of life that she made and kept along the way. She created a warm and welcoming sanctuary where any and all could come and count on a cheery smile, a good chat, delicious food and a crisply made bed.
Dale loved her family, dogs, bright colors, swimming in her pool, basking in the sun, travel, gardening and a nice hot bath. She also loved her colleagues and her work at the Dedham Women’s Exchange, where she volunteered for over 40 years.
Dale leaves her children, Elisa Dooley (and husband Tom), Charles Cabot III (and wife Sarah), and Emily Chamblin (and husband Bill), as well as her eight grandchildren and seven great grandchildren. She is also survived by her sister, Sharon Sands (and husband Frank), and her brother, Harry Giles.
Dale’s family would like to thank her wonderful, devoted and compassionate caregivers.
